    My Sir and I are a little less then two months into our D/s journey. He also had/has the same worries your Sir has. He didn’t want me to loose who I am because that is who he fell in love with. Similar to Sir’s Succubus we started with a few rules and are adding from there. I am also not where I want to be but I know this lifestyle change can be hard for Sir and it cannot be rushed. My Sir implemented a respectful tone rule. We have two little children and although this is 24/7 for us using Sir in front of my children just isn’t what we want. With that said when the kids are awake I can say what I please as long as my tone is respectful. This allows me to be me without getting myself in trouble. lol.

    Three months ago I would have never thought that this is what I wanted but from the moment my Sir asked me I have slowly been becoming the women that I have always wanted to be but have struggled to get there. I have found myself stress free, feeling sexy in my own body and being more healthy with my daily choices. In my opinion I believe your submission is based on the guidelines each of you have put together. Your submission doesn’t mean you loose yourself I believe it means you gain yourself. You learn things about yourself you never knew and you are no longer afraid to explore those things others might questions because you have an open communication with your Sir. What works for us is our “swiss” day. Every Sunday after bedtime Sir and I move into a “Switzerland zone” where I am free to discuss anything that I need to and don’t have to worry to much about whether it will upset him because it is a neutral zone. During this time we also discuss the rules we have if they’re working or need to be changed. I feel this has helped with allowing me to be me without disobeying Sir.
